Permenkaret
20th November 2011, 01:49 AM
Kakak-kakak semua, saya butuh pendampingan dan bimbingan nih buat pembuatan program Database Anggota menggunakan Visual Basic dan database access (*.mdb).
Langsung aja ya kak,,
Mungkin pertama-tama akan saya list dulu apa yang sudah saya lakukan:
Sebelum saya list semua yang sudah saya lakuin, didalam spoiler dibawah ini tampilan awal program sederhana saya
Spoiler for tampilan program awal:
http://farm2.static.flickr.com/1218/5107162522_fe6630c7f9_z.jpg
Pertama :
Saya sudah membuat database dengan menggunakan microsoft access yang bernama anggota.mdb. Yang isi di dalamnya itu Table anggota dan field nya adalah:
Nama
Kelahiran
Alamat
Kampus
Jurusan
Program
Angkatan
Kom
Phone
Kedua :
Saya sudah membuat 4 Form, yaitu:
- Form1=frmawal (gambar diatas)
- Form2=frminput
- Form3=frmcari
- Form4=frmdata.
namun 3 Form selain Form1, belum saya apa-apakan alias masih polos.
Code di dalam Form1 itu seperti dibawah ini;
Quote:
Private Sub cari_Click()
frmcari.Visible = True
End Sub
Private Sub close_Click()
End
End Sub
Private Sub data_Click()
frmdata.Visible = True
End Sub
Private Sub Form_Load()
Set db = New ADODB.Connection
db.Open = "provider=microsoft.jet.oledb.4.0;datasource=" & App.Path & "\anggota.mdb"
Set rs = New ADODB.Recordset
End Sub
Private Sub input_Click()
frminput.Visible = True
End Sub
Yang saya blok diatas itu adalah yang diblok oleh VB ketika keluar error. saya gak tau errornya kenapa. Isi errornya seperti dibawah ini:
Quote:
Compile error :
Expected function or variable
Ketiga :
Saya sudah membuat satu buah module yang isi didalamnya seperti ini:
Code:
Global db As ADODB.Connection
Global rs As ADODB.Recordset
Sekarang beranjak ke pertanyaan ya kak... :D :naikkuda:
1- Error yang sempet muncul itu di akibatkan kenapa?
2- Apabila ada kesalahan dalam penulisan code diatas, bagaimana yang benarnya..?
3- Bagaimana cara mengkoneksikan Database access dengan Visual Basic yang benar? (point ini sepertinya permasalahan intinya, jadi mohon kasih tutorial yang lengkap dan jelas ya kak :naikkuda: )
Bagaimana saya bisa menginput, edit dan pencarian data kalau koneksinya aja belum berhasil... http://static.kaskus.us/images/smilies/sumbangan/8.gif
nanti saya akan lihat siapa yang paling intent membantu saya, akan saya kasih melon dalam seminggu berturut-turut... :melonndan:
Terimakasih sebelumnya, dan mohon dimaklum kalo ada kesalahan... :loveindonesia :ceriwislove:
</div>
Langsung aja ya kak,,
Mungkin pertama-tama akan saya list dulu apa yang sudah saya lakukan:
Sebelum saya list semua yang sudah saya lakuin, didalam spoiler dibawah ini tampilan awal program sederhana saya
Spoiler for tampilan program awal:
http://farm2.static.flickr.com/1218/5107162522_fe6630c7f9_z.jpg
Pertama :
Saya sudah membuat database dengan menggunakan microsoft access yang bernama anggota.mdb. Yang isi di dalamnya itu Table anggota dan field nya adalah:
Nama
Kelahiran
Alamat
Kampus
Jurusan
Program
Angkatan
Kom
Phone
Kedua :
Saya sudah membuat 4 Form, yaitu:
- Form1=frmawal (gambar diatas)
- Form2=frminput
- Form3=frmcari
- Form4=frmdata.
namun 3 Form selain Form1, belum saya apa-apakan alias masih polos.
Code di dalam Form1 itu seperti dibawah ini;
Quote:
Private Sub cari_Click()
frmcari.Visible = True
End Sub
Private Sub close_Click()
End
End Sub
Private Sub data_Click()
frmdata.Visible = True
End Sub
Private Sub Form_Load()
Set db = New ADODB.Connection
db.Open = "provider=microsoft.jet.oledb.4.0;datasource=" & App.Path & "\anggota.mdb"
Set rs = New ADODB.Recordset
End Sub
Private Sub input_Click()
frminput.Visible = True
End Sub
Yang saya blok diatas itu adalah yang diblok oleh VB ketika keluar error. saya gak tau errornya kenapa. Isi errornya seperti dibawah ini:
Quote:
Compile error :
Expected function or variable
Ketiga :
Saya sudah membuat satu buah module yang isi didalamnya seperti ini:
Code:
Global db As ADODB.Connection
Global rs As ADODB.Recordset
Sekarang beranjak ke pertanyaan ya kak... :D :naikkuda:
1- Error yang sempet muncul itu di akibatkan kenapa?
2- Apabila ada kesalahan dalam penulisan code diatas, bagaimana yang benarnya..?
3- Bagaimana cara mengkoneksikan Database access dengan Visual Basic yang benar? (point ini sepertinya permasalahan intinya, jadi mohon kasih tutorial yang lengkap dan jelas ya kak :naikkuda: )
Bagaimana saya bisa menginput, edit dan pencarian data kalau koneksinya aja belum berhasil... http://static.kaskus.us/images/smilies/sumbangan/8.gif
nanti saya akan lihat siapa yang paling intent membantu saya, akan saya kasih melon dalam seminggu berturut-turut... :melonndan:
Terimakasih sebelumnya, dan mohon dimaklum kalo ada kesalahan... :loveindonesia :ceriwislove:
</div>